Chloe Update!

You guys may remember that last week I took Chloe in to have her urine checked. When Chloe first came to us, her family believed she had a bladder tumor. It turned out she actually had four very large bladder stones that required surgery. The type of stones she had can recur if her urine pH isn’t maintained, so one of the most important parts of her ongoing care is routinely monitoring her urine.

Today, while Zeus was at his appointment, I was able to take in Chloe’s urine sample for testing. The news couldn’t have been better.

Dr. Molly’s exact words were, “Chloe’s urine is boring.” 😂

Coming from Dr. Molly, that’s the highest compliment! Usually, when she sees crystals or something unusual under the microscope, she gets so excited explaining what she’s seeing. She has a way of talking about it like she’s looking at a beautiful piece of art. But today? Nothing exciting to report…and that’s exactly what we wanted!

No crystals. Her urine pH is right where it should be. Everything looks normal.
